Apparently, the 2022 World Cup, one of the largest sporting events in the world, is going to be changing things up a little…
Instead of being held in June/July, it’s going to be held in the winter!
Say whaaaaat??
Yup, the winter. The problem is the World Cup game is going to be played in Qatar in the Middle East and it gets impossibly hot there.
So hot that they’re worried they won’t actually be able to play the game!
The Secretary General of FIFA, Jerome Valcke, said:
“The dates for the World Cup (in Qatar) will not be June to July. To be honest, I think it will be held between November 15 and January 15 at the latest.
If you play between November 15 and the end of December that’s the time when the weather conditions are best, when you can play in temperatures equivalent to a warm spring season in Europe, averaging 25 degrees.
That would be perfect for playing football.”
